AbstractPenalty methods have been proposed as a viable method for enforcing interelement continuity constraints on nonconforming elements. Particularly for fourth‐order problems in whichC1‐continuity leads to elements of high degree or complex composite elements, the use of penalty methods to enforce theC1‐continuity constraint appears promising. In this study we demonstrate equivalence of the finite‐element penalty method to a hybrid method and provide a stability analysis which implies that the penalty method is stable only if reduced integration of a certain order is used.
